次の方法で共有


CodeActionKind 列挙型

定義

さまざまな種類のコード アクションを表す列挙型。

詳細については、 言語サーバー プロトコルの仕様 に関するページを参照してください。

public enum class CodeActionKind
[Newtonsoft.Json.JsonConverter(typeof(Newtonsoft.Json.Converters.StringEnumConverter))]
[System.Runtime.Serialization.DataContract]
public enum CodeActionKind
[<Newtonsoft.Json.JsonConverter(typeof(Newtonsoft.Json.Converters.StringEnumConverter))>]
[<System.Runtime.Serialization.DataContract>]
type CodeActionKind = 
Public Enum CodeActionKind
継承
CodeActionKind
属性
Newtonsoft.Json.JsonConverterAttribute DataContractAttribute

フィールド

Empty 7

コード アクションは空です。

QuickFix 0

コード アクションは簡単な修正です。

Refactor 1

コード アクションはリファクタリングです

RefactorExtract 2

コード アクションは、メソッド、関数、変数などを抽出するためのリファクタリングです。

RefactorInline 3

コード アクションは、インライン化メソッドや定数などのリファクタリングです。

RefactorRewrite 4

コード アクションは、メソッドを静的にするなどの書き換えアクションのリファクタリングです。

Source 5

コード アクションは、ファイル全体に適用されます。

SourceOrganizeImports 6

コード アクションは、インポートを整理するためのアクションです。

適用対象